Kansas Statutes § 3-144c Same; contract; resolution; deed.
Before a city transfers real estate, its governing body must negotiate sale contracts; once a contract is accepted and the acceptance resolution is recorded, the city’s mayor and clerk may execute and deliver the deed to the purchaser.
